RE: Titan MediaBrowser skin - taurus35 - 2015-04-08

(2015-04-08, 01:21)marcelveldt Wrote: I've just posted a new beta version of the skin helper that should fix the mentioned problems. Besides fixing the issue I've added a nice search dialog for the videolibrary

Hi Marcel,

Even with the latest updates I am still unable to get to the Movie or TV Show widgets if there aren't any "inprogress" library items. I just tried a test on my Windows library (which I just use for testing) & I had two movies which were partially watched & was able to get to the widget by pressing up. After marking both movies as watched I was unable to get to the widget by pressing up.

Cheers
